.ProductCard_wrap__ZhIFG{position:relative;display:flex;flex-direction:column;background:#fff;border-radius:8px;transition:all .3s;height:auto;width:100%}.ProductCard_link__IzjRv{position:absolute;top:0;left:0;width:100%;height:100%;display:block;z-index:2}.ProductCard_image__bxBV_{margin-bottom:6px}.ProductCard_image__bxBV_ img{aspect-ratio:1/1;border-radius:20px;height:auto;width:100%}.ProductCard_content__ryLsT{display:flex;flex-direction:column;flex-grow:1}.ProductCard_nameWrap___9tLR{margin-bottom:4px;overflow:hidden;text-overflow:ellipsis;white-space:nowrap}.ProductCard_name__ANouh,.ProductCard_preOrder__VBaAc{position:relative;display:inline-flex;align-items:center;justify-content:center;background:rgba(0,0,0,0);border-radius:8px;color:#1b1d22;font-size:12px;line-height:16px;padding:0;max-width:max-content;height:16px;margin-right:10px}.ProductCard_name__ANouh:before,.ProductCard_preOrder__VBaAc:before{content:"";position:absolute;display:block;top:50%;left:-5px;background:#1b1d22;border-radius:50%;height:1px;width:1px}.ProductCard_name__ANouh:first-child:before,.ProductCard_preOrder__VBaAc:first-child:before{content:none}.ProductCard_preOrder__VBaAc{color:#1b1d22}.ProductCard_description__AXXxp{font-size:14px;line-height:140%;word-break:break-word;margin-bottom:4px}.ProductCard_description__AXXxp span{-webkit-line-clamp:2;max-height:40px}.ProductCard_counter__Od_Dg{display:flex;gap:4px;font-size:14px;line-height:20px;margin-top:auto;color:#848e9c}.ProductCard_productItemVerticalStats__Rj4O0{display:flex;gap:12px;font-size:14px;line-height:140%;margin-bottom:10px}@media(max-width:660px){.ProductCard_productItemVerticalStats__Rj4O0{font-size:12px}}.ProductCard_hide__gCq6g{display:none}.ProductCard_priceWrap__H6ChV{display:flex;align-items:center;flex-wrap:wrap;color:#1d2230;font-size:14px;line-height:140%;margin-bottom:2px}.ProductCard_price__k1Ahq{font-size:20px;font-weight:700;line-height:24px;margin-right:8px;color:#1d2230;margin-bottom:2px}.ProductCard_oldPrice__sMmpI{opacity:.5;text-decoration:line-through}.ProductCard_buttonWrapper__jbW64{margin-top:12px}.ProductCard_button__bNDtX{z-index:10}.ProductCard_overClampTwo__1smyI{display:-webkit-box;-webkit-line-clamp:2;-webkit-box-orient:vertical;overflow:hidden;text-overflow:ellipsis}.ProductCard_overClampTwo__1smyI span{-webkit-line-clamp:2;max-height:40px}.ProductCard_overClampUnitPrice__wfB4V{display:-webkit-box;-webkit-line-clamp:3;-webkit-box-orient:vertical;overflow:hidden;text-overflow:ellipsis}.ProductCard_overClampUnitPrice__wfB4V span{display:block}.BottomGoods_title__63iDs{font-size:32px;font-weight:700;line-height:40px;margin-bottom:20px}@media(max-width:768px){.BottomGoods_title__63iDs{font-size:20px;line-height:24px;margin-bottom:16px}}.BottomGoods_cards__5r9XZ{display:grid;grid-template-columns:repeat(6,minmax(0,1fr));grid-gap:20px 28px;margin-bottom:32px}@media(max-width:1090px){.BottomGoods_cards__5r9XZ{grid-template-columns:repeat(5,minmax(0,1fr))}}@media(max-width:992px){.BottomGoods_cards__5r9XZ{grid-template-columns:repeat(4,minmax(0,1fr))}}@media(max-width:768px){.BottomGoods_cards__5r9XZ{grid-template-columns:repeat(3,minmax(0,1fr));grid-gap:16px 12px;margin-bottom:16px}}@media(max-width:460px){.BottomGoods_cards__5r9XZ{grid-template-columns:repeat(2,minmax(0,1fr))}}.BottomGoods_productCardWrap__L8ARQ:before{content:none}.NotFound_pageError__Fsj0o{padding:44px 0 80px}.NotFound_content__4orx0{display:flex;flex-direction:column;align-items:center;justify-content:center;gap:20px;margin-bottom:40px}@media(max-width:767px){.NotFound_content__4orx0{gap:0}}.NotFound_title__9qXdz{font-size:40px;font-weight:600;line-height:130%}@media(max-width:767px){.NotFound_title__9qXdz{font-size:24px;margin:24px 0 8px}}.NotFound_description__56N5a{line-height:150%;text-align:center;margin-bottom:20px;max-width:404px;width:100%}@media(max-width:767px){.NotFound_description__56N5a{margin-bottom:24px}}.NotFound_link__po3ao{display:inline-flex;justify-content:center;color:#1a5ee5;transition:color .25s;width:100%}.NotFound_link__po3ao:hover{color:#0546c7}.NotFound_btn__8QRwO{display:inline-flex;align-items:center;justify-content:center;border-radius:8px;background:#eff1f6;color:#1d2230;padding:0 16px;height:40px}